Exporting tea is an intricate process influenced by several customs and regulations. Understanding these elements can streamline your export operations.
Ensure that you comply with all necessary documentation, including invoices, export licenses, and quality certificates to facilitate smooth customs clearance.
Familiarize yourself with potential tariffs and duties that may apply to your shipments. Understanding these costs is crucial for pricing your products competitively.
Stay informed about trade agreements between countries, as these can significantly affect your export capabilities and costs.
